Problem

Current online asset display tracking systems lack real-time auditing capabilities and are vulnerable to fraud, making it difficult to accurately measure ad placement and click-throughs, especially in sensitive areas like political advertising where integrity and compliance are critical.

Innovation Solution

A digital asset management system that employs state-of-the-art cryptographic signing techniques using JSON Web Tokens (JWT) for secure and immutable tracking of ad serving activities, ensuring every transaction is signed and verified, creating a complete audit trail for real-time monitoring and fraud detection.

AI summary

An online content asset distribution system tracks content asset consumption and detects fraudulent attempts to access online content assets. The system also tracks online asset campaigns such as online political campaigns.
